Python库nlpia-0.0.31:自然语言处理工具包

版权申诉
0 下载量 161 浏览量 更新于2024-10-20 收藏 47.68MB GZ 举报
资源摘要信息:"Python库 | nlpia-0.0.31.tar.gz" nlpia-0.0.31.tar.gz 是一个压缩的Python库文件,通过官方渠道发布,支持Python编程语言。该库属于自然语言处理(Natural Language Processing,简称NLP)领域,是进行语言数据相关任务处理的重要资源。它提供了许多用于自然语言分析、处理和理解的工具和接口,可以方便开发者快速实现NLP相关的功能和算法。 nlpia库提供了一系列的自然语言处理工具和函数,可以用于文本的预处理、词性标注、命名实体识别、语义分析、情感分析等多种文本处理任务。开发者可以利用这个库来开发包括但不限于以下的应用: 1. 文本分类:自动将文本数据分配到一个或多个类别中,例如新闻分类、邮件垃圾过滤等。 2. 情感分析:识别和提取文本中的情绪倾向,判断文本内容是正面、负面还是中立。 3. 实体识别:从文本中识别出具有特定意义的实体,如人名、地名、组织名等。 4. 关键词提取:从一段文本中提取出核心的关键词。 5. 语义相似度:判断两段文本或句子之间的语义相似程度。 6. 机器翻译:尽管不是主要功能,但NLP库常包含基础的翻译能力。 7. 自动摘要生成:从较长的文档中提取出关键信息,形成摘要。 由于该库的版本为0.0.31,它可能包含了一些新特性和功能改进,但相对也可能存在一些未解决的bug或者兼容性问题。使用之前建议开发者仔细阅读官方文档和安装指南,确保了解如何正确安装和使用该库,以及了解版本特性,以便更好地应用于项目中。 为了安装nlpia库,可以参考给出的安装方法链接,通常涉及Python包管理工具pip的操作。例如,使用pip安装命令如下: ```bash pip install nlpia-0.0.31.tar.gz ``` 在安装过程中,如果遇到任何问题,可以参考官方文档或社区论坛寻求帮助。安装成功后,开发者可以开始利用nlpia库中丰富的资源和功能来开发强大的NLP应用程序。 该库的使用门槛相对较低,适合有一定Python编程基础并对NLP感兴趣的开发者。但是,为了充分利用库中提供的功能,建议开发者具备一定的自然语言处理知识。此外,对于机器学习和深度学习领域的知识也可能在某些复杂功能的实现中成为必要条件。 在技术标签方面,nlpia-0.0.31.tar.gz属于"python 综合资源"类别,表明它是一个综合性的Python资源包,可以为开发者提供方便的自然语言处理工具集,同时它也是"开发语言 Python库"的一部分,说明它是一个面向Python开发者的库资源。由于其功能广泛,可能在多个子领域中得到应用,包括但不限于人工智能、数据科学、机器学习等。 总结来说,nlpia-0.0.31.tar.gz为Python开发者提供了一个强大的工具箱,能够协助进行自然语言处理相关的开发工作。由于属于官方资源,开发者可以信赖其稳定性和安全性,并且可以期待官方提供的持续更新和技术支持。通过使用这个库,开发者可以更加高效地实现复杂的NLP任务,无需从零开始编写大量底层代码。